WebChickens can eat sausage. Sausage you are going to serve the chickens must not be too seasoned or contain a lot of salt content. Sausage can serve once in a while for chickens. You serve some leftovers of sausage to the chickens if they are yet to spoil or Moldy. Just make sure the salt content in the sausage is not too much. Chickens can eat sausage yes. As long as it’s a high meat percentage sausage that’s not too heavy on the spices, additives, and other filler that some sausages have. Keep it simple, make sure it’s well cooked, and you’ll have a very happy flock! See more There are almost endless types of sausagein the world. Most countries seem to have their own national favorite, but there are some … See more Generally speaking, cooked meats are fine for chickens. Raw meat, on the other hand, is not. So, as long as the sausage has been properly cooked, it should be fine for your chickens to eat.
